Miami Vice

         Episode 56

Down For The Count

            Part 1

Original air date: 01/09/1987

The episode starts out at a boxing match. We have seen this arena before in the episode Milk Run, all though they have dressed up the exterior differently. We see Crockett and Tubbs arrive with Zito and Switek. They park on the water side or east side of the old Coast Guard Hangar at Dinner Key. Other than the name being clearly visible the exterior does not appear as it is normally seen. That is because they have covered over the windows on the hangar door and placed signs with canopies over them on the actual door. Apparently they did not plan on opening the door in the near future. We also see this location used in the movie All About The Benjamins.

This is the same door that Crockett and Tubbs come out of when they follow Louis Martinez in Milk Run.

I placed a star in the approximate location of Where Tubbs, Crockett, Switek, and Zito sit down.

C+T park here.

Next, we cut to Guzman’s house the next day. This was filmed at 1415 North View Drive, Sunset Island, Miami Beach. We have seen this same house used previously in Miami Vice. Episode 28, Junk Love.

Then we see the standard season 3 opening montage (Version 8).

Act 1 opens inside the OCB, a set at Greenwich Studios, Stage A.

Then we see Crockett and Tubbs on the road. In the first section they are in a business area with an elevated highway in the background. In the second part of the drive they are in a residential area that I have not placed yet. Location unknown.

Then they arrive at Don Cash’s home. Surprisingly Mr. Cash lives with Mr. Guzman, or at least they used the same house for filming this scene. This was filmed at 1415 North View Drive.

Then we return to the OCB (set).

Then we see C+T arrive at Guzman’s, 1415 North View Drive. They come from Lake Avenue onto North View Drive and into Guzman’s.

At Guzman’s they go about entrapping him.

Then we go to a boxing gym where Bobby is training. Thanks to Pinkflaming0 working with the group effort at miamiviceonline.com, we now know that this was filmed at 3555 NW 18th Avenue, Allapattah.

Then we see an exterior establishing shot of a trailer park. This park appears to be on a hillside and is likely reused stock footage from California.

Then we go inside the trailer. This was likely filmed at the studio or in the trailer park on the south side of the studio. Location unknown.

Then we go to the Bravo Gym on NW 18th Avenue. In the background and out the door we see the Allapattah Branch Library which is located at 1799 NW 35th Street

Then we return to Guzman’s on North View Drive.

Then it is back to Moon’s trailer. Location unknown.

Things do not go well for Moon and we see the Vice Squad arrive on the scene.

Then we go to the NW 18th Avenue gym.

Then we see Larry and Bobby go for a walk. This was filmed at Dinner Key near the Verick Arena in the same spot where we saw C+t talking with Izzy in episode 20, Nobody Lives Forever.

Then we return to the NW 18th Avenue gym where Guzman sends George Sordoni to make a contract offer to Bobby.

Then we see Crockett and Tubbs headed southbound through the 5300 block of Collins Avenue.

Then it cuts and they continue on their drive but the shot is too close to tell where they are.

Then we see them arrive at the NW 18th Avenue gym where they make a deal with Bobby.

Then we cut to a boxing match. This was filmed at Verrick Arena.

Then we cut to the OCB interior where Crockett pushes things along.

Then we cut to the arena locker room area. Location unknown.

Then we go to a bout between Hector Hidalgo and Bobby Sykes. This is set up to be the Miami Palmetto Arena but the filming location is unknown. Possibly a set at Greenwich.

Then we see Larry and Stan back stage in the locker room area. Location unknown.

Then we cut to the workout gym (3555 NW 18th Ave.) where Larry is putting things away. Guzman’s goons show up and very sadly it does not go well.

Then we see Stan arrive.

One of the saddest scenes of all time. The episode ends here but the story is to be continued...
